VirtualBox

source: vbox/trunk/src/VBox/VMM/VMMR0

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@74061   6 years vboxsync VMM: Nested VMX: bugref:9180 vmlaunch/vmresume bits.
(edit) @74047   6 years vboxsync VMM/IEM, HM: Nested VMX: bugref:9180 vmlaunch/vmresume bits.
(edit) @74016   6 years vboxsync VMM/HMVMXR0: space.
(edit) @74014   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Make use of IEM decoded APIs for …
(edit) @74005   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Use a macro for …
(edit) @73998   6 years vboxsync VMM/HMVMXR0: nit.
(edit) @73994   6 years vboxsync VMM/HMVMXR0: space.
(edit) @73991   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Duplicate return (copy/paste bug).
(edit) @73988   6 years vboxsync VMM/HMVMXR0: Make sure RSP, segment regs are imported as it's required …
(edit) @73987   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Use IEMExecDecodedVmread from the …
(edit) @73985   6 years vboxsync VMM/HMVMXR0: Renamed VMX_EXIT_XDTR_ACCESS.
(edit) @73984   6 years vboxsync VMM/HM, IEM: Renamed VMX_EXIT_XDTR_ACCESS and VMX_EXIT_TR_ACCESS.
(edit) @73983   6 years vboxsync VMM/IEM, HM: Nested VMX: bugref:9180 Implement VMREAD, added using …
(edit) @73959   6 years vboxsync VMM/IEM, HM: Nested VMX: bugref:9180 Use VMXEXITINFO to pass decoder …
(edit) @73943   6 years vboxsync VMM/HMVMXR0: Comment.
(edit) @73770   6 years vboxsync VMM/HMVMXR0: Revert r124436 (VMCLEAR is needed for setting launch …
(edit) @73754   6 years vboxsync VMM/HVMXMR0: const nit.
(edit) @73753   6 years vboxsync VMM/HMVMXR0: We shouldn't need to VMCLEAR before VMPTRLD before …
(edit) @73708   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Add missing VM-exit instruction …
(edit) @73627   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 todo regarding raising #SS on …
(edit) @73620   6 years vboxsync VMM/HMVMXR0: Unused functions build fix.
(edit) @73617   6 years vboxsync VMM/HMVMXR0: Use IEMExecOne() rather than manually interpreting a …
(edit) @73609   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Build fix.
(edit) @73607   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Darwin build fix.
(edit) @73606   6 years vboxsync VMM: Nested VMX: bugref:9180 Various bits: - IEM: Started VMXON, …
(edit) @73471   6 years vboxsync VMM,DBGF: Improved unwinding of ring-0 assertion stacks, making the …
(edit) @73437   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Fix bug while injecting …
(edit) @73422   6 years vboxsync VMM: Nested VMX: bugref:9180 bitfield macro nits.
(edit) @73389   6 years vboxsync VMM, SUPDrv: Nested VMX: bugref:9180 Implement some of the VMX MSRs.
(edit) @73348   6 years vboxsync DBGF,DBGC,GIMHv: Added some basic windows bug check formatting …
(edit) @73327   6 years vboxsync NEM/win: Do CR3 flush/update from ring-0 when we can (requires setjmp …
(edit) @73323   6 years vboxsync NEM/win: Deal with DRx state import assertions if DR7 isn't already …
(edit) @73311   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Cleanups, add new VMCS bits.
(edit) @73310   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Some much needed shortening of …
(edit) @73293   6 years vboxsync VMM, SUPDrv: Nested VMX: bugref:9180 Read VMX true control MSRs, dump …
(edit) @73292   6 years vboxsync VMM/HM: Nested VMX: bugref:9180 Rename u64VmxBasicInfo to suit spec.
(edit) @73291   6 years vboxsync VMM/HM: Nested VMX: bugref:9180 Renamed MSR_IA32_VMX_BASIC_INFO to …
(edit) @73288   6 years vboxsync VMM/HM: Hex digit nits.
(edit) @73287   6 years vboxsync VMM: Reordering some STAT counters, spaces and nits.
(edit) @73282   6 years vboxsync NEM/win: Kicked out VINF/VERR_NEM_UPDATE_APIC_BASE and …
(edit) @73281   6 years vboxsync APIC: Made APICSetBaseMsr work in ring-0 and raw-mode context without …
(edit) @73280   6 years vboxsync HM,PGM: Clarify VINF_PGM_CHANGE_MODE return and update assertions. …
(edit) @73274   6 years vboxsync VMM: Nested VMX: bugref:9180 Reports bits of IA32_FEATURE_CONTROL, …
(edit) @73266   6 years vboxsync PGM,HM: Made PGMR3ChangeMode work in ring-0 too. This required a …
(edit) @73264   6 years vboxsync VMM/HM: bugref:9193 Remove unused code after using …
(edit) @73255   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Naming consistency.
(edit) @73254   6 years vboxsync VMM/HMVMXR0: Nested VMX: bugref:9180 Naming consistency.
(edit) @73253   6 years vboxsync PGM,HM: Added todos about cleaning up the nested packing hacks. …
(edit) @73203   6 years vboxsync VMM, Devices: bugref:9193 Remove unused code after using …
(edit) @73180   6 years vboxsync VMM/HMVMXR0: nit.
(edit) @73179   6 years vboxsync VMM/HMVMXR0: bugref:9193 Try use EMRZSetPendingIo[Read|Write] …
(edit) @73166   6 years vboxsync VMM/HMSVMR0: Try use EMRZSetPendingIoPort[Read|Write] interface for …
(edit) @73152   6 years vboxsync VMM/HMSVMR0: Fix missing import bits required by IEMExecDecodedxxx.
(edit) @73151   6 years vboxsync VMM/HMSVMR0: Enable NRIP_SAVE again on trunk, fixed missing import …
(edit) @73144   6 years vboxsync VMM/HMSVMR0: LogRel nit.
(edit) @73143   6 years vboxsync VMM/HMSVMR0: VMM/HMSVMR0: Log some features used for nested-guest …
(edit) @73141   6 years vboxsync VMM/HMSVMR0: Log some features used for nested-guest execution (most …
(edit) @73140   6 years vboxsync VMM/HMSVM: Sort out state syncing on #VMEXIT, VMRUN transitions. We …
(edit) @73115   6 years vboxsync VMM/HMSVMR0: nit.
(edit) @73114   6 years vboxsync VMM/HMSVMR0: Build fix.
(edit) @73113   6 years vboxsync VMM/HMSVMR0: Build fix.
(edit) @73112   6 years vboxsync VMM/HMSVMR0: Build fix, unused variable.
(edit) @73111   6 years vboxsync VMM/HMSVMR0: Fix vmmcall, pause, TPR patching for CPUs that don't …
(edit) @73097   6 years vboxsync *: Made RT_UOFFSETOF, RT_OFFSETOF, RT_UOFFSETOF_ADD and …
(edit) @73067   6 years vboxsync VMM/HMSVMR0: Comment.
(edit) @73057   6 years vboxsync VMM/HMSVMR0: nit.
(edit) @73056   6 years vboxsync VMM/HMSVMR0: bugref:9193 Attempted fix for VMRUN.
(edit) @73055   6 years vboxsync VMM/HMSVMR0: bugref:9193 Attempt to fix regression with nested SVM …
(edit) @73054   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ix mov crx write.
(edit) @73053   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ix mov crx read.
(edit) @73052   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ix mwait.
(edit) @73051   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ix monitor.
(edit) @73050   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ix hlt.
(edit) @73049   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ix invlpg.
(edit) @73048   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ix rdpmc.
(edit) @73047   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ix rdtscp.
(edit) @73046   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ix rdtsc.
(edit) @73045   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ix invd.
(edit) @73044   6 years vboxsync VMM/HMSVMR0: bugref:9204 temporarily disable NRIP_SAVE across the …
(edit) @73043   6 years vboxsync VMM/HMSVMR0: bugref:9204 Fix wbinvd.
(edit) @73042   6 years vboxsync VMM/HMSVMR0: bugref:9204 Comment fix, replaced release assertion with …
(edit) @73035   6 years vboxsync NEM/win: Poll timers from inner loop and adjust run/wait timeout to …
(edit) @73016   6 years vboxsync VMM/HM: Changed HM_CHANGED_XCPT_RAISED_MASK to …
(edit) @73015   6 years vboxsync VMM/HMSVMR0: Fallback to IEMExecOne() on certain VM-exits on CPUs that …
(edit) @73002   6 years vboxsync VMM/HMVMXR0: Don't need to recheck VMCPU_FF_TLB_FLUSH when it's just …
(edit) @72995   6 years vboxsync VMM/HMVMXR0: Attempted build fix.
(edit) @72994   6 years vboxsync VMM/HMVMXR0: Attempted build fix for mac rel.
(edit) @72993   6 years vboxsync VMM/HMVMXR0: Spaces, nit, doxygen.
(edit) @72992   6 years vboxsync VMM/HMVMXR0: Stat nits.
(edit) @72991   6 years vboxsync VMM/HM: Stat nits.
(edit) @72990   6 years vboxsync VMM/HMVMXR0: Don't update exit-history PC while exporting guest-state …
(edit) @72989   6 years vboxsync VMM/HMVMXR0: Comment.
(edit) @72988   6 years vboxsync VMM/HMVMXR0, HMSVMR0: Eliminate hidden parameters from a few macros …
(edit) @72987   6 years vboxsync VMM/HMVMXR0: bugref:9193 Stop passing pCtx around and use …
(edit) @72986   6 years vboxsync VMM/HMVMXR0: Nit.
(edit) @72985   6 years vboxsync VMM/HMVMXR0: bugref:9193 Stop passing pCtx around and use …
(edit) @72984   6 years vboxsync VMM/HMVMXR0: Spaces.
(edit) @72983   6 years vboxsync VMM/HM, HMVMX: bugref:9193 Stop passing pCtx around and use …
(edit) @72970   6 years vboxsync VMM/HMSVM: ​bugref:9193 Stop passing pCtx around and use …
(edit) @72969   6 years vboxsync VMM/HMSVM: bugref:9193 Stop passing pCtx around and use …
Note: See TracRevisionLog for help on using the revision log.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ette